This notebook was designed to be used with the fly fusion (grey or black version--the use the same everything, and the pens are the exact same thing, besides the color). The notebooks have (I think) 100 to 150 pages in them, and are very thick. They last a lot longer than an average notebook, and are much more useful. The notebook pages have thousands of tiny dots (that cannot be seen unless you look very close) that track where you are on the page, what you're writing, and what you're doing. On the front cover of the notebook is the control panel which lets you adjust the volume, use a calculator, turn the recording feature ON or OFF, play Mp3's, set reminders, check the battery level/memory status/ memory available/etc, check the date/time, ... Perhaps it's that the rest of us--dad, mom, and fourteen-year-old brother--have had years of playing video games with better complexity and far better graphics, but I'm not wowed by any of the Clickstart games. Yes, I know, they're for young children, but even the web-based games for toddlers have better graphics and are sometimes more user-friendly.
That said, my three-year-old does like the Clickstart, and is able to navigate it without help. The Toy Story game isn't all that impressive, for the money, but that's a complaint I have about Clickstart cartridges in general.
